Add an animation to a layer
- Select the visual layer in the Scene Editor.
- In the hover menu, click Animation.
- Choose a preset from the dropdown, or select Custom.

Remove an animation
- Select the animated layer in the Scene Editor.
- Click Animation in the hover menu.
- Open the options menu for the animation.
- Select Remove.

While most use cases can be handled via scene transitions, a custom animation allows for more granular control of how a visual element appears, moves, or changes. Define the start and end using keyframes, then adjust properties like position, size, and opacity.Add and adjust a custom keyframe animation
- Select a visual in the Scene Editor.
- Click Animation, then select Custom.
- Your animation appears in the timeline with two keyframes.

- Select the start keyframe and adjust position, size, rotation, cropping, or opacity.
- Repeat for the end keyframe.
- Press
Escto exit animation mode.
